Ex-Muslim joins rightwing Freedom Party

Freedom Party leader Geert Wilders confirmed Thursday that ex-Muslim Ehasan Jami, 24, has joined the party, which is highly critical of Islam. DPA reports that the self-identified ex-Muslim and critic of Islam may run for a council seat in The Hague in the upcoming 2010 local elections, or may enter politics following the general elections of 2011.

Jami was previously a member of the left-wing Labour party, but was expelled in 2007 after writing an op-ed essay together with Wilders in which they compared Mohammed with Adolf Hitler.
